Certificates of deposit (CDs) offered by Edward Jones are bank-issued and FDIC-insured up to $250,000 (principal and interest accrued but not yet paid) per depositor, per depository institution, for each account ownership category. A brokered CD is a certificate of deposit purchased through an investment brokerage firm instead of from a bank.
